The Patuxent Research Refuge is a haven for nature lovers and outdoor enthusiasts. This vast wildlife sanctuary offers hiking trails, fishing spots, and opportunities for wildlife viewing. As you drive through the refuge, keep an eye out for diverse bird species and native plants. The visitor center provides informative exhibits about local ecosystems. Ample parking is available, making it easy to start your adventure. Consider packing a picnic to enjoy in one of the designated areas after exploring the trails.
Historic London Town and Gardens offers a fascinating glimpse into colonial America. This living history museum features reconstructed buildings, beautiful gardens, and interactive exhibits. As you drive to the site, you'll enjoy scenic views of the South River. The attraction offers convenient parking for visitors. After touring the historic area, take a leisurely stroll through the woodland gardens. Don't miss the opportunity to participate in hands-on colonial crafts demonstrations or attend one of the special events held throughout the year.
Kinder Farm Park is a delightful destination for families and nature enthusiasts alike. This working farm turned public park offers a unique blend of recreational activities and agricultural education. As you drive to the park, you'll pass through picturesque countryside. The park provides ample parking for visitors. Explore the historic farm buildings, hike the nature trails, or let the kids enjoy the playgrounds. Don't forget to visit the animal barns to see farm animals up close. The park also hosts seasonal events, making it a great year-round destination.
Here's how to reach Gambrills:
• By plane: Fly into Baltimore/Washington International Thurgood Marshall Airport, then rent a car to drive to Gambrills.
• By train: Take Amtrak to BWI Marshall Rail Station, then rent a car for the short drive to Gambrills.
• By car: If driving from nearby cities, use major highways like I-97 or MD-3 to reach Gambrills.

When driving on rural backroads around Gambrills, especially at night, caution is key. Always use your headlights and be prepared for sudden curves or wildlife crossings. Reduce your speed to allow for better reaction time on unfamiliar roads. Keep a safe following distance from other vehicles and be aware of potential blind spots. If renting an SUV or larger vehicle, familiarize yourself with its dimensions for narrow passages. During nighttime drives, watch for reflective signs indicating sharp turns or intersections. Stay alert for farm equipment or deer, particularly at dawn and dusk. By following these practices, you'll enhance your safety while enjoying the scenic rural drives around Gambrills in your rented vehicle.

When renting a car and driving from Gambrills to other parts of Maryland, be aware of several toll roads in the region. The Baltimore-Washington Parkway (Route 295) is free, but connecting roads may have tolls. If heading towards Baltimore, you might encounter tolls on I-95 or I-895. The Chesapeake Bay Bridge also requires a toll when traveling eastbound. Some roads use electronic tolling, so discuss toll payment options when renting your vehicle. It's wise to keep some cash on hand for any cash-only toll booths. By planning your route in advance and being prepared for potential tolls, you can ensure a smoother driving experience while exploring Maryland in your rented car.
